The IT Compliance Analyst will be a key team member in our growing and impactful organization as SailPoint continues to scale globally as the industry leader in Identity Governance. This position will report to the Manager of Privileged Access Management (PAM) & IT Compliance and will support SailPoints internal Privileged Access Management (PAM) & compliance systems and operations.
As a Compliance Analyst you will be coordinating IT activities in order to maintain compliance with SOC2 FedRAMP ISO27001 and GDPR and will provide guidance to help streamline and automate our compliance processes.
Responsibilities
Coordinate quarterly semi-annual and annual user access reviews and provide audit support including generating reports developing documentation and performing completeness and accuracy checks
Proactively identify areas of improvement and suggest projects to improve controls while maintaining a positive team atmosphere
Assist with cross-team remediation project tasks
Collect and develop documentation for internal and external auditors
Manage compliance tools/ create dashboards to present compliance data
Provides IT administrative support for financial systems
Perform other related duties and responsibilities as needed
Requirements
US Citizenship
Knowledge of compliance or audit testing
Project management skills and ability to balance multiple projects simultaneously to meet objectives and key deadlines
Ability to work independently and collaborate effectively across teams and management levels
Strong organizational skills with a drive to succeed in a fast-paced environment
Ability to maintain confidentiality and build strong relationships across cross-functional teams
Preferred Qualifications
Knowledge with SOX FedRamp or GDPR compliance frameworks
Knowledge with IT controls for SOC2 ISO27001 or FedRamp
CISA CRISC or other related certification is a plus
Experience working in a regulated environment or auditing technology companies
Experience working within a compliance system/tool to automate compliance activity
Benefits and Compensation listed vary based on the location of your employment and the nature of your employment with SailPoint.
As a part of the total compensation package this role may be eligible for the SailPoint Corporate Bonus Plan or a role-specific commission along with potential eligibility for equity participation. SailPoint maintains broad salary ranges for its roles to account for variations in knowledge skills experience market conditions and locations as well as reflect SailPoints differing products industries and lines of business. Candidates are typically placed into the range based on the preceding factors as well as internal peer equity. We estimate the base salary for US-based employees will be in this range from (min-mid-max USD):
$46100 - $65900 - $85700Base salaries for employees based in other locations are competitive for the employees home location.
